Transaction 8f03599e26597cb57b1ba367513177862cd4e75fa89960ec5e69529a089fc84f
1 Input
1 Output
-
8f03599e26597cb57b1ba367513177862cd4e75fa89960ec5e69529a089fc84f:0
- value
- 1598000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88d536159e4f0233666531f82942229ee38cc2c0 OP_EQUAL
- address
- A4umyf5DrZa88SnE6YFSpoV3m7LsBJ7NtL